Job Description

JOB DESCRIPTION

Highland Realty Capital is seeking an experienced commercial mortgage broker or capital advisor to secure assignments from sponsors to arrange debt and equity for commercial and multi-family property investments within an assigned territory. The ideal candidate will have an existing book of business that will benefit from Highland’s sophisticated debt and joint venture placement capabilities and exceptional relationships with institutional capital sources. This individual will be assigned to the East Bay and greater Sacramento markets, who is ideally already based in the East Bay.  Office location is flexible.  The role will be 100% commission based, however, Highland offers very competitive splits, uncapped earnings, and the assigned territory is nearly wide open for this new originator.  

 

MAIN RESPONSIBILITIES

  • Generates debt and/or equity financing opportunities from his or her knowledge of industry players, networking, cold calling, and attending trade shows;
  • Self-starter willing to create, implement, and manage his or her own marketing plan;
  • Attend networking events, meetings, conferences, site visits, and other work-related functions;
  • Input data related to the capital markets and grow/refine Highland’s proprietary database;
  • Prepare and/or oversee the creation of Excel underwriting pro-formas and Financing Memorandums for own pipeline, for distribution to potential lenders or investors; and
  • Manage and oversee the due diligence/closing process of own pipeline.

 

PREFERRED SKILLS / EXPERIENCE

  • 5+ years of experience in the commercial real estate or commercial lending industry with at least 2-5 years in a results-oriented production role, successfully achieving or exceeding revenue targets;
  • Preference for candidates with an existing book of business;
  • Self-motivated individual eager to solicit new business consistently via cold calls, meetings and networking events;
  • Strong analytical skills; experience in Excel-based financial modeling is required;
  • Strong writing skills; experience compiling investment or credit summaries;
  • Bachelor’s Degree or greater in real estate, finance, economics, business, or related discipline; and
  • CA Real Estate Salespersons License required.

 

TECHNICAL SKILLS

  • Required:
    • Microsoft Excel, Word, PowerPoint, Adobe PDF, and Outlook
    • CRM (Salesforce or Microsoft Dynamics)
    • CoStar or Similar Research Database
